Abai Square is a central public square in Almaty named for the Kazakh poet and philosopher Abai Qunanbaiuly. It functions as a civic and cultural space and is closely associated with neighbouring cultural buildings.
The square is notable for the monument to Abai and for being sited beside major institutions, including the city’s opera and ballet theatre, which hosts regular performances and makes the area a cultural hub. The open space is used for public gatherings, ceremonies and as a pedestrian axis in the city centre.
Located in the core of Almaty, the square sits within the city’s downtown and is served by public transport and major avenues.

What to See #
- Abai Opera and Ballet Theatre: The Abai Opera and Ballet Theatre sits adjacent to the square and forms one side of the public space, providing a cultural anchor and regular evening performances.
- Abai statue: A statue of the Kazakh poet and cultural figure stands within the square and serves as a focal point for ceremonies and photographs.
How to Get to Abai Square #
Located in central Almaty near the intersection of avenues Mire and Abai; reachable on foot from Republic Square (about a 10-15 minute walk). Local buses and taxis serve the area; the nearest metro station is ‘Baikonur’ on Line 1 (walking distance depending on your route).

Weather & Climate near Abai Square #
Abai Square's climate is classified as Hot-Summer Continental - Hot-Summer Continental climate with warm summers (peaking in July) and freezing winters (coldest in January). Temperatures range from -10°C to 30°C. Moderate rainfall (551 mm/year).
